Integer Overflow Vulnerability in Huawei AR3200 Devices
CVE-2017-15343
7.5HIGH
What is CVE-2017-15343?
The Huawei AR3200 devices exhibit an integer overflow vulnerability due to insufficient validation of fields in SCTP messages. An unauthenticated remote attacker could exploit this weakness by sending crafted SCTP messages, potentially leading to unexpected system reboots. Users of affected software versions should prioritize updating their systems to mitigate the associated risks.
Affected Version(s)
AR3200 V200R006C10,V200R006C11,V200R007C00,V200R007C01,V200R007C02,V200R008C00,V200R008C10,V200R008C20,V200R008C30
